CMWS 650 - Topics in Environmental Fluids - 3 credits Prerequisite(s): CMWS 530 , CMWS 600 , and with instructor consent Course focuses on specialized topics in applied fluid mechanics. Topics could include turbulence, air-sea interactions, meteorology, atmospheric dynamics, sediment transport, voluntary layers, and ocean surface waives as they pertain to our understanding of environmental fluid systems. One specialized topic will be offered on a rotational basis in parallel with the instructor’s expertise. Students can take this class more than once to help prepare for their research thesis provided the specialized topic is not the same. Semester(s) Offered: Spring
